Sports Washing and Nostalgic Dance

This chapter explores the phenomenon of sports washing through the lens of the Saudi-backed Live Golf initiative while addressing its implications on human rights visibility. Additionally, it transports listeners to a lively dance competition set in the 1981 Hyatt Regency in Kansas City, blending historical context with personal storytelling.
